Traditional automotive repair, particularly for wheel alignment and undercarriage work, often required vehicles to be positioned over service pits or supported by jacks. These methods proved inefficient and physically demanding, contributing to chronic back problems among technicians. In-ground lifts solve these challenges by retracting flush with the shop floor when not in use, then rising smoothly to create an adjustable, spacious work area when needed.

Among in-ground lift systems, the AA4C AA-ALSL40 has gained recognition for its performance and thoughtful engineering. Key features distinguish this model:
The lift's maximum elevation (1.8m in standard configuration) provides comfortable access for wheel alignment, undercarriage inspection, tire service, and general maintenance. This design significantly reduces technician strain while improving service quality.
With a 4,000kg load rating, the system accommodates most passenger vehicles including SUVs, minivans, and light commercial trucks, expanding service capabilities for repair shops.
The generous platform length ensures stable positioning for long-wheelbase vehicles, with integrated sliding plates facilitating rear wheel adjustments during alignment procedures.
When not in use, the completely flush-mounted platform maximizes available floor space—a critical advantage for urban repair facilities.
An auxiliary lift mechanism (450mm travel) enables targeted elevation of specific vehicle sections for specialized repairs or precise alignment adjustments.

Additional thoughtful touches include interchangeable cover plates for different vehicle configurations, multiple color options, and a low 210mm retracted height accommodating sports cars.
| Parameter | Specification |
|---|---|
| Maximum Capacity | 4,000kg (4 metric tons) |
| Auxiliary Lift Capacity | 2,500kg |
| Maximum Lift Height | 1,800mm (standard configuration) |
| Auxiliary Lift Height | 450mm |
| Retracted Height | 210mm |
| Platform Dimensions | 4,500mm x 600mm |
| Lift Time | 50-60 seconds (full elevation) |
| Power Requirements | 2.2kW motor (220V/380V options) |
